Taiwan market: Handset sales up 10% sequentially in July 2009

Sales of handsets in the Taiwan market grew by 10% sequentially in July from 536,700 shipped in June, but were down 3.3% compared to a year earlier, according to data compiled by retail channels in Taiwan.

However, the share of the iPhone 3G in terms of sales value dropped to 2% in July from 4.5% in June as consumers were waiting for the launch of the iPhone 3GS scheduled at the end of August, the data showed.

Nokia remained the top handset vendor in the local market, taking up an over 30% share in terms of unit sales, the data indicated.
